Migration Museum

Today our class visited the Migration Museum in town. We left school at 9:00 and then we walked down to the bus stop. When we got into town, we walked to the Migration Museum.
When we got there we ate our recess then we were put into groups for an activity. We had to search through a person’s suitcase or box and find out who he or she was there was also some paperwork. In the end we watched a small video about how and why our person migrated. It was really interesting learning about the different reasons that people migrated for example better education, jobs and money.
The excursion was different to what I expected because we did one activity and we didn’t go into the museum.

Literacy-Expanding Noun Groups

in Literacy this week we have been learning about expanding our sentences. We start off with a pointer e.g The,he,she. Then a Quantifier (number). Next you put a Qualifier (size,shape,colour) and before the noun you put the Classifier (type) e.g ADELAIDE zoo, AUSTRALIAN athlete. After the noun you write end of the sentence. You didn’t have to use all them  and you can add adjectives.

Example- The four mean, cunning, intimidating politicians used their power to convince us that the murray had dried up so that we wouldn’t use any more water.

It really helped me Write better quality sentences.
